? Un schéma de base de données relationnelle sont les tables , les colonnes et les relations qui constituent une base de données relationnelle. Un schéma est souvent représenté visuellement dans un logiciel de modélisation tels que ERwin ou un logiciel de dessin comme Viso . Le but d'un schéma
Un schéma de base de données relationnelle vous permet d'organiser et de comprendre la structure d'une base de données. Ceci est particulièrement utile lors de la conception d'une nouvelle base de données , la modification d'une base de données existante pour soutenir plus de fonctionnalités , ou la construction de l'intégration entre les bases de données.
La création du schéma
Il ya deux étapes à la création d' un schéma de base de données relationnelle : la création du schéma logique et la création du schéma physique . Le schéma logique décrit la structure de la base de données, montrant les tables, les colonnes et les relations avec d'autres tables dans la base de données et peut être créé avec les outils de modélisation ou d'un tableur et un logiciel de dessin. Le schéma physique est créé en générant réellement les tables , les colonnes et les relations dans le logiciel de gestion de base de données relationnelle (SGBDR) . La plupart des outils de modélisation permettent d'automatiser la création du schéma physique du schéma logique, mais il peut aussi être fait par manuellement .
La modification du schéma
structure d'une base de données relationnelle changera inévitablement avec le temps en fonction des besoins de données changement. Il est tout aussi important de documenter les changements à votre schéma de base de données relationnelle comme il était de documenter la conception originale, sinon il devient de plus en plus difficile de mettre à jour ou intégrer la base de données . Assurez-vous d' enregistrer des copies des configurations précédentes , de sorte que des changements peuvent être retirées en cas de problème .